International racing series Powerboat P1 has announced its schedule for 2015, with six stop-overs in the UK for the SuperStock class.

Starting in Singapore in April, the P1 SuperStock 250 race series sees some of the world’s most powerful monohull boats go head-to-head at speeds of up to 70mph. More than 180 racers took part in the 2014 series.

Next year’s UK events will take place in London and Scarborough during May, Gosport in June, Hull (July), Cardiff (August), and Bournemouth (September).

The Scarborough event will take place over the weekend of 30-31 May. Exact dates for the other legs are yet to be confirmed.

Scarborough Borough Council has promised to put on plenty of entertainment for powerboat fans visiting the Yorkshire coast town, including live race commentary and prize draws.

Mike Cockerill, cabinet member for harbours at Scarborough Borough Council, said: “The West Pier and harbour areas will be a hive of activity during the weekend and will also be good vantage points from which to take in the adrenaline-fuelled action.

“By making the best use of the space and facilities the harbour has to offer, the activity off the water is set to be just as enjoyable as the action on the water.”

The 20-race series, which will be televised on Sky Sports, ends in October at the American venue of St Petersburg, Florida.

James Durbin, CEO of Powerboat P1, said: “With new deals secured to enhance our already extensive TV distribution, we are confident that the interest and commercial value of marine motorsport is increasing significantly.”

Founded in 2003, Powerboat P1 features four classes, ranging from jet-skis and RIBs to the more powerful SuperStock 150 and SuperStock 250 classes.
